Lovely breakfast, especially the sausages. Plenty of choice. Good to see the bar promoting local breweries such as Eyam and stocking Pipers Crisps. Friendly bar / waiting staff. The room had a great ensuite and the shower temperature was just right. Excellent location for the countryside and the rest of the village - there is a bus stop to Bakewell opposite and a stop for Sheffield literally outside the hotel . Hathersage Train Station is not too far either and the famous Hathersage Open Air lido is just up the street. The bar was lively in the evening with a good atmosphere of locals and tourists/walkers. I'd happily stay there again.
The bedroom could get a little bit stuffy. The size of the double bed was not generous. The bar prices were expensive (more than my local in SE London) but it was the same at the other pubs we went to in the village so not just The Little John. There is very little to dislike about the place so perhaps I'm nit picking a bit.

The staff are all friendly. The pub menu is a good variety, should you choose to dine in. The breakfast is a buffet option, with fruit, cereal and yoghurts served in addition to a full English option and a selection of teas and coffee and fruit juice. Served between 8am- 9 am in the comfortable spacious dining area. Room was a good size and had everything you need, loved the plentiful coffee, tea and hot chocolate selection with biscuits, bathroom has complimentary soap and hand cream. Parking was available on the premises which was a bonus and check in was in the bar area of the pub and very efficient and welcoming.
Extended breakfast time until 10am would be good. As a relaxing getaway trip, it didn't leave much for a lie in! That being said we're were up and out to enjoy a lovely walk, so I guess that's good too enjoy the morning air! The bed was extremely soft, I appreciate this may suit some and seemed a small double, certainly cosy.
